1 November - All Saints Day

This is a special day for Catholic families. Today they visit the graves of loved ones. They ensure the gravestone is clean, and light candles, leave flowers, sweets, fruit, biscuits, cigarettes, raki...
Members of the family will stand around the grave and speak to the departed loved one.

I'm not 100% sure of the whole reason to this, but I think it has to do with the belief that although the "soul" of the loved one is dead, it cannot get into heaven, but through the actions of the living relatives, they can make it "good" enough to get through the pearly gates.

